Assisted Living Costs in Sisters Oregon
When exploring the serene and picturesque town of Sisters in Oregon, one finds a community deeply connected to its natural surroundings, offering a tranquil lifestyle for its residents, including those who require assisted living services. The cost of assisted living in this charming locality is a crucial factor for families considering long-term care options for their loved ones.
In Sisters, Oregon, the average monthly cost for assisted living hovers around $6,364, which is slightly above the state average reported by the long-term care financial company Genworth, which stands at $5,825 per month. This cost encompasses a range of services typically offered in assisted living facilities, including housing, meals, and assistance with daily activities like dressing, bathing, and medication management.
Residents of Sisters have the added advantage of being in proximity to reputable healthcare facilities, such as St. Charles Medical Center - Bend, St. Charles Bend, and St. Charles Family Care. These institutions ensure that high-quality medical care is accessible, providing peace of mind for both residents and their families.
For those worried about the financial aspect of assisted living, it is important to note that government support programs may be available. In Oregon, Medicaid offers options through various waiver programs that can help eligible seniors cover the costs of assisted living. Families need to investigate these avenues to secure the necessary support for their loved ones.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Sisters, Oregon
When it comes to choosing the right care for yourself or a loved one in Sisters, Oregon, understanding the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ities is crucial for making an informed decision.
Assisted Living facilities offer a blend of independence and assistance. Residents live in private or semi-private apartments and receive help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These facilities often provide communal dining, social activities, and transportation services. They are ideal for individuals who can still live somewhat independently but require some assistance.
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as standalone communities, provide specialized care for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other memory impairments. These facilities feature secure environments designed to prevent wandering, with staff trained to handle the unique challenges of memory loss. Therapeutic activities and structured routines are common in Memory Care to help maintain cognitive functions.
Nursing Homes, or Skilled Nursing Facilities, offer the highest level of care outside of a hospital. They provide 24-hour medical supervision and are staffed with licensed nurses and healthcare professionals. Residents typically have complex medical needs that require regular attention, including post-surgical care, rehabilitation services, or chronic condition management.
Independent Living communities cater to seniors who can live on their own without the need for daily assistance. These facilities offer private apartments or houses with community amenities such as fitness centers, group activities, and maintenance services. They are perfect for active seniors seeking a community environment with the option for social engagement.
Each type of facility in Sisters, Oregon, serves a specific population based on their care needs and levels of independence. Assessing the individual needs of the person in question is the first step in determining which facility is the most suitable choice.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Sisters Oregon
Qualifying for assisted living in Sisters, Oregon, involves several key steps and requirements that ensure residents receive the appropriate level of care. Firstly, individuals must typically undergo a health assessment conducted by a healthcare professional. This assessment evaluates a person's physical and cognitive needs to determine if assisted living is the most suitable environment for their care.
In Oregon, there are certain eligibility criteria for assisted living. Prospective residents should demonstrate the need for ass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and meal preparation. It's important to note that assisted living facilities are designed for those who do not require the intensive medical and nursing care provided in a nursing home but still need some level of help.
Financially, the cost of assisted living can be a significant consideration. In Sisters, Oregon, as in many other places, the expense can be managed through personal savings, long-term care insurance, or retirement benefits. Additionally, government programs like Medicaid can be utilized to help cover costs, provided the individual qualifies. In Oregon, the Medicaid program includes options like the Community First Choice Plan and the Aged and Physically Disabled waiver, which may cover services in assisted living under certain conditions.
To take advantage of these programs, one must meet both financial and functional eligibility criteria. For financial eligibility, this typically means meeting specific income and asset limits. Functionally, the individual must require a nursing home level of care.
For those looking to qualify for assisted living in Sisters, it's advisable to start by consulting with local assisted living facilities about their specific admission requirements. They can also guide navigating the financial aspects and applying for government assistance. Additionally, contacting the Oregon Department of Human Services can provide further information on eligibility and application processes for state-funded assistance programs.
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Sisters, Oregon
Assisted living offers a blend of independence and care for seniors who require assistance with daily activities but do not need the intensive medical and nursing care provided in a nursing home. In the charming town of Sisters, Oregon, assisted living facilities provide a unique experience for residents, combining the beauty of the Pacific Northwest with the comforts of home-like amenities.
One of the primary advantages of assisted living in Sisters is the environment. Nestled in the scenic Cascade Range, residents can enjoy breathtaking views and a serene lifestyle that is often conducive to both physical and mental well-being. The small-town charm of Sisters, with its artisanal shops and community events, ensures that residents have opportunities for socialization and engagement, which are vital for maintaining a high quality of life.
Furthermore, assisted living facilities in Sisters are known for their personalized care and attention to individual needs. With a lower staff-to-resident ratio compared to larger cities, caregivers can form closer relationships with residents, leading to more tailored support and a homely atmosphere.
However, there are disadvantages to consider as well. The cost of living in Sisters can be higher than in other regions, which might be reflected in the pricing of assisted living services. This can be a significant factor for seniors with limited retirement savings or those relying on fixed incomes. Additionally, because Sisters is a smaller community, there may be fewer assisted living options available, limiting choices for style, size, and the range of services offered.
For seniors who prioritize a peaceful setting and a close-knit community, Sisters, Oregon can be an excellent choice for assisted living. However, it is important for individuals and families to carefully assess the financial implications and the variety of services available to ensure that the facility meets their specific needs and expectations.
